Exhibit "A" <br /> Scope of Work <br /> March 16, 2010 <br /> The City of Pleasanton Operations Services Department (CITY) has purchased Continental Utility <br /> Solutions, Inc (CUSI)'s Customer Information System software, herein referred to as UMS.net. In <br /> conjunction with the purchase of UMS.net, CITY requires software enhancements be made and <br /> implementation services be rendered under the terms and conditions of the Software Purchase and <br /> Professional Services Agreement between CUSI and CITY dated March 16, 2010. <br /> Scope <br /> This Statement of Work (SOW) will define the work to be performed by CUSI and CITY which shall <br /> include but not be limited to services to be rendered, activities to be performed, responsibilities of the <br /> parties, and a complete Project Plan for the delivery and implementation of UMS.net. <br /> Project Management <br /> CUSI and CITY will each provide project managers who will be responsible for all resource scheduling, <br /> day to day activities and oversight of the project. Project managers will be responsible for and oversee all <br /> other resources working on the project. <br /> PHASE1: DISCOVERY <br /> CUSI Responsibilities: <br /> CUSI will performed a review of both functional and technical business processes for the <br /> CITY including but not limited to the following areas: <br /> o General business requirements <br /> o Meter reading requirements <br /> o Service and work orders requirements <br /> o Rates, billing, credit and collections requirements <br /> o Reporting requirements <br /> o Data conversion requirements <br /> o Interface requirements <br /> CUSI will document business requirements as collected and understood, then will submit to <br /> the CITY for approval. <br /> CITY Responsibilities <br /> The CITY will provide resources with the following subject matter expertise: Business <br /> process requirements: <br /> General information (ie: account setup) <br /> Meter reading requirement <br /> Service and work orders requirements <br /> Rates, billing, credit and collections requirements <br /> Data conversion requirements <br /> Interface requirements <br /> The CITY is responsible for confirming all requirements documented and presented. <br /> Page 1 <br />
